NASHVILLE, Tenn. – The Commodores received a No. 11 national ranking when the Intercollegiate Women’s Lacrosse Coaches Association released its preseason poll on Tuesday. Head Coach Cathy Swezey’s squad features 11 returning starters and a group of seven seniors.
For the 2009 campaign, Vanderbilt earned its third consecutive NCAA Tournament berth while finishing with a 10-7 overall record.
Among those starters returning are seniors Sarah Downing and Alex Mundy, who each received All-America and All-Conference honors in 2009. Downing set single-season school records in goals scored (55) and points (81), leading a high-powered offensive attack. On the other end of the field, Mundy was a defensive force for the Commodores as she led the team with 43 ground balls as well as recording 13 draw controls and 23 caused turnovers.
The IWLCA Top 20 Poll features three other teams from the American Lacrosse Conference, including Northwestern (No. 1), Ohio State (No. 16), and Penn State (No. 18). The Wildcats, who will be gunning for their sixth straight national championship, received all 20 first place votes.
For the 2010 season, the Commodores will face eight teams from the IWLCA Top 20.
The ‘Dores will open their season this Sunday, playing host to No. 5 Duke at the Vanderbilt Lacrosse Complex. The game is scheduled to start at 1 p.m. CT.
